| +// When a peripheral device's battery level is <= kLowBatteryLevel, consider |
| +// it to be in low battery condition. |
| +const int kLowBatteryLevel = 15; |
| + |
| +// Don't show 2 low battery notification within |kNotificationIntervalSec| |
| +// seconds. |
| +const int kNotificationIntervalSec = 60; |
| + |
| +// HID Bluetooth device's battery sysfs entry path looks like |
| +// "/sys/class/power_supply/hid-AA:BB:CC:DD:EE:FF-battery". |
| +// Here the bluetooth address is showed in reverse order and its true |
| +// address "FF:EE:DD:CC:BB:AA". |
| +const char kHIDBatteryPathPrefix[] = "/sys/class/power_supply/hid-"; |
| +const char kHIDBatteryPathSuffix[] = "-battery"; |
| + |
| +bool IsBluetoothHIDBattery(const std::string& path) { |
| + return StartsWithASCII(path, kHIDBatteryPathPrefix, false) && |
| + EndsWith(path, kHIDBatteryPathSuffix, false); |
| +} |
| + |
| +std::string ExtractBluetoothAddress(const std::string& path) { |
| + int header_size = strlen(kHIDBatteryPathPrefix); |
| + int end_size = strlen(kHIDBatteryPathSuffix); |
| + int key_len = path.size() - header_size - end_size; |
| + if (key_len <= 0) |
| + return std::string(); |
| + std::string reverse_address = path.substr(header_size, key_len); |
| + StringToLowerASCII(&reverse_address); |
| + std::vector<std::string> result; |
| + base::SplitString(reverse_address, ':', &result); |
| + std::reverse(result.begin(), result.end()); |
| + std::string address = JoinString(result, ':'); |
| + return address; |
| +} |
